Cala Pi on Mallorca's rugged southern coast offers some of the best dolphin watching in the Balearic Islands. The deep blue waters just offshore are a natural highway for common and striped dolphins, often seen playing in the bow waves of boats. This isn't a crowded, commercial trip—it's a genuine encounter with marine life in a stunning setting.

Local captains know exactly where to find these intelligent creatures, usually within 20 minutes of leaving Cala Pi's small harbor. The area's underwater canyons attract abundant fish, which in turn draw pods of dolphins. Guests often see mothers teaching calves to leap, creating unforgettable moments against the backdrop of dramatic limestone cliffs.

A typical excursion lasts two to three hours, offering plenty of time to appreciate the dolphins' natural behavior without disturbing them. The boats are small and respectful, keeping a safe distance while still providing excellent viewing. This is a chance to connect with the Mediterranean's wild heart, far from the island's busier resorts.

Cala Pi itself is a quiet fishing village with a beautiful crescent beach, making it an ideal base for this adventure. After the trip, visitors can explore the nearby watchtower or enjoy fresh seafood at a local restaurant. Dolphin watching here is a serene, authentic Mallorcan experience that stays with you long after you leave.

What to expect

  • Guided boat tour departs from Cala Pi's small harbor at 10am and 2pm daily.
  • Dolphins are sighted on over 90% of trips, with pods averaging 15 animals.
  • Boat holds maximum 12 guests for a personal, uncrowded experience.
  • Life jackets and safety briefing provided before departure.
  • Snacks and water included, but guests should bring sunscreen and a hat.
  • Tour lasts 2.5 hours, with binoculars available on board.
  • Captains share local knowledge about dolphin behavior and Cala Pi's history.
  • Respectful viewing distance ensures wildlife remains undisturbed and calm.
